My name is Cheryl and I was sleeved a little over a year ago. At the start of my journey I weighed 542 pounds. Now I'm excited to say that I only tip the scales at 330 lbs. Needless to say, life has been somewhat of an adventure over the last year or so. I have been amazed at the doors opened to me. Everything has changed that's for sure! I no longer have to sit on the side lines of life, for once I actually get to play in the game. Not really sure what else to say. I've never been on one of these before. So...I guess I'm just hoping to make some new friends that can understand what life is like following WLS.

Got one question. Just curious, has any of you lost weight just to find that you've lost friends too. I've been kicked out of the "fat chick club." I just don't get it. I'm still fat! Fatter than most of them. I'm still the same person, just a more positive outlook on life.
